The Science of Sleep


Rest is a complicated biological process crucial for physical and mental health. It includes distinctive phases, managed by body clocks and affected by hormone task. Recognizing these parts is essential for appreciating exactly how they impact rest top quality and total well-being.


Phases of Rest


Sleep consists of several stages, primarily classified right into REM (Rapid Eye Movement Sleep) and non-REM phases. Non-REM sleep is further separated right into three stages: N1, N2, and N3.



  • N1: Light rest, where one can be conveniently stired up.

  • N2: Moderate sleep, crucial for memory combination.

  • N3: Deep sleep, important for physical recovery and development.


Rapid eye movement occurs concerning 90 mins after sleeping and is essential for dreaming and cognitive functions. Each cycle lasts about 90 mins and repeats several times during the evening. A sleep doctor stresses the significance of stabilizing these phases to make sure restorative rest.


Circadian Rhythms and Sleep-Wake Cycle


Body clocks are natural, internal processes that duplicate approximately every 24-hour and regulate the sleep-wake cycle. These rhythms respond to ecological signs, mainly light and darkness.


The suprachiasmatic nucleus (SCN) in the brain regulates these rhythms, affecting melatonin manufacturing. Melatonin, a hormone launched in feedback to darkness, signals the body to get ready for sleep. Interruption of body clocks, such as via shift job or uneven rest patterns, can lead to sleep problems, exhaustion, and lowered awareness. Sleep medical professionals suggest maintaining regular rest routines to sustain these biological rhythms.


Hormones and Their Effect on Sleep


Hormones play a substantial duty in regulating sleep patterns. Apart from melatonin, cortisol is another crucial hormonal agent that influences rest.



  • Melatonin: Advertises drowsiness and controls body clocks.

  • Cortisol: Commonly referred to as the anxiety hormonal agent, comes to a head in the early morning to advertise awareness however can disrupt sleep if elevated during the evening.


Other hormones, like development hormonal agent, are released during deep rest, sustaining tissue repair work and muscle mass development. Disturbances in hormone equilibrium can result in sleeplessness or hypersomnia. Consulting a sleep doctor can aid analyze hormone effect on rest top quality.



Common Sleep Disorders


Rest problems can dramatically disrupt day-to-day live and impact general health and wellness. Comprehending these typical problems can aid in identifying signs and symptoms and seeking ideal therapy.


Sleep problems


Sleeping disorders is defined by problem dropping or remaining asleep. People might experience a series of symptoms, consisting of exhaustion, state of mind disturbances, and damaged focus. Causes can be varied, including anxiety, anxiety, poor rest behaviors, or medical problems.


Therapy frequently entails behavioral therapies, such as Cognitive Behavioral Therapy for Sleeplessness (CBT-I). This approach resolves the underlying thoughts and actions influencing rest. In some cases, medicine may be suggested for short-term relief, yet it's not constantly suggested for chronic sleeping disorders.


Rest Apnea


Rest apnea includes duplicated interruptions in breathing during rest. One of the most usual kind is obstructive sleep apnea, where the throat muscle mass intermittently kick back and obstruct the airway. Signs consist of snoring, wheezing for air throughout sleep, and daytime tiredness.


Medical diagnosis commonly entails a sleep study. Therapy alternatives may include way of life adjustments, continual favorable respiratory tract stress (CPAP) makers, or surgery in extreme situations. Managing rest apnea is important, as it can result in serious health and wellness issues, including cardiovascular troubles.


Troubled Legs Syndrome


Uneasy Legs Syndrome (RLS) creates an uncontrollable urge to move the legs, typically accompanied by awkward sensations. Signs worsen in the evening or at night, bring about difficulties in dropping off to sleep. Elements adding to RLS might consist of genes, iron shortage, and specific medicines.


Administration strategies commonly consist of lifestyle modifications, such as regular workout and preventing caffeine. In some instances, medications like dopaminergic representatives or anticonvulsants might be required to reduce signs and improve sleep top quality.


Narcolepsy


Narcolepsy is a neurological condition impacting the mind's ability to manage sleep-wake cycles. People usually experience excessive daytime drowsiness, abrupt sleep assaults, and, sometimes, cataplexy, which is an unexpected loss of muscle tone caused by strong feelings.


Diagnosis typically involves a sleep study and multiple sleep latency tests. Therapy focuses on taking care of symptoms through medications that promote wakefulness and behavior adaptations. Staying notified about triggers can boost the quality of life for those influenced by narcolepsy.



Influence of Sleep on Health And Wellness and Health and wellbeing


Appropriate rest is important for preserving optimum health and wellbeing. Sleep straight affects physical health, psychological states, and immune function, highlighting the requirement for individuals to prioritize restorative remainder.


Physical Health Impacts


Insufficient sleep can cause several physical health and wellness concerns. Persistent rest starvation is related to a raised danger of problems such as weight problems, diabetic issues, and cardiovascular diseases.


When rest patterns are interfered with, hormonal agents controling appetite and metabolism might be influenced. This inequality can lead to harmful weight gain.


Moreover, many rest experts highlight that quality rest is crucial for muscle mass recuperation and cells repair work. Individuals that routinely acquire adequate rest usually report higher power levels and improved physical performance.


Mental Health and Cognitive Impacts


Sleep is elaborately connected to mental health and wellness and cognitive performance. Poor sleep high quality can intensify signs and symptoms of stress and anxiety and anxiety, leading to a cycle of unrest and emotional distress.


Cognitive processes such as memory loan consolidation and decision-making are considerably endangered with poor rest.


Research study indicates that individuals may fight with emphasis and analytic capabilities when deprived of rest. Those that check out thorough sleep centers usually receive assessments that highlight the connection between sleep top quality and mental well-being.


Improving rest health can boost mood and cognitive quality, making remainder a necessary component of mental health methods.


Rest and Immune System Function


The body immune system relies heavily on top quality rest to work effectively. During deep rest, the body produces cytokines, proteins that play a vital role in combating infections and inflammation.


Rest deprival can minimize immune feedbacks, making people more at risk to health problem.


Sleep experts note that chronic lack of rest might lead to a boosted chance of viral infections and long term healing times. To keep durable immune feature, prioritizing rest is important.


Integrating excellent sleep methods into everyday routines can reinforce immunity and general health and wellness.



Strategies for Better Sleep


Implementing reliable approaches can significantly enhance rest quality and overall health and wellbeing. The adhering to techniques focus on developing a helpful rest environment and creating behaviors that advertise restorative rest.


Rest Hygiene


Sleep hygiene involves techniques that produce perfect conditions for sleep. Crucial element consist of preserving a constant sleep schedule and creating a comfortable sleep setting.



  • Consistency: Going to sleep and awakening at the same time each day aids manage the body's internal clock.

  • Environment: An amazing, dark, and peaceful bed room promotes much better rest. Think about power outage drapes, eye masks, or white noise machines to block out disturbances.

  • Limitation Naps: Short snoozes can be advantageous, but long or irregular napping during the day can adversely influence nighttime rest. Go for 20-30 min naps if required.


Stay clear of electronics and brilliant displays a minimum of one hour before bedtime to reduce blue light direct exposure, which can disrupt melatonin production.


Diet and Workout


Diet plan and workout play vital functions in rest health. Consuming the right foods at proper times can improve sleep top quality.



  • Dish Timing: Stay clear of heavy meals near to bedtime. Rather, go with light snacks that are high in carbs and low in protein.

  • Caffeine and Alcohol: Minimize caffeine consumption, especially in the afternoon and evening. Alcohol might assist sleep but can disrupt sleep cycles later on in the night.


Regular exercise contributes to far better rest. Participating in moderate workout, such as strolling or biking, for at least thirty minutes most days can aid with rest start and duration. Nonetheless, exercising also close to going to bed can have the opposite effect, so aim for earlier in the day.


Leisure and Stress And Anxiety Management Strategies


Efficient leisure and tension management strategies can assist calm the mind before rest.



  • Mindfulness and Reflection: Methods such as deep breathing, reflection, or yoga can reduce stress and anxiety levels and promote relaxation. They assist lower cortisol, a hormone that can hinder rest.

  • Going to bed Routine: Establish a soothing pre-sleep routine. Activities like reading or taking a warm bathroom signal to the body that it's time to unwind.


Avoid emotionally charged discussions or tasks right before going to bed, as they can enhance stress and anxiety and tension.



Expert and Medical Treatments


Seeking professional aid is vital for resolving sleep problems efficiently. Various interventions, varying from consultations with sleep specialists to certain therapies, can substantially enhance sleep health.


When to Get In Touch With a Sleep Medical Professional


Individuals should think about getting in touch with a sleep physician if they experience persistent rest problems such as chronic sleep problems, sleep apnea, or serious snoring. Observing signs and symptoms like excessive daytime sleepiness or problem concentrating can additionally indicate a requirement for expert assistance.


A rest physician, usually part of an extensive sleep facility, can perform analyses to detect rest problems. These experts utilize tools like sleep studies, which keep an eye on breathing, heart rate, and mind activity during sleep. Early intervention can stop long-term wellness problems and improve total quality of life.


Therapies Used by Sleep Centers


Thorough sleep centers use a range of therapy alternatives tailored to details sleep conditions. Therapies might consist of c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T) for sleeplessness, which properly deals with negative idea patterns bordering sleep.


Rest centers likewise provide Continual Positive Respiratory tract Pressure (CPAP) treatment for those diagnosed with rest apnea. This device provides a constant flow of air to maintain respiratory tracts open throughout rest, substantially decreasing sleep disturbances.


Additionally, sleep professionals may suggest way of living alterations, such as boosting rest health, developing a regular rest routine, and minimizing high levels of caffeine consumption. These modifications can improve the efficiency of medical interventions.


Medications and Behavioral Therapy


In some cases, medications might be suggested to resolve rest disruptions. Typical options include benzodiazepines and non-benzodiazepine sleep help. These drugs can aid handle signs, yet they are typically advised for temporary use due to possible negative effects.


Behavioral therapy complements drug by assisting individuals create healthier rest routines. Methods such as leisure training, stimulation control, and sleep restriction therapy can be effective in dealing with sleeplessness.


Combining medicine with behavioral therapy often brings about better end results. Each method targets various elements of rest health, adding to more efficient and lasting services for people experiencing sleep difficulties.



Technical Developments in Rest Researches


Recent advancements in modern technology have transformed rest researches, offering much better devices for understanding sleep patterns and conditions. These advancements include using wearable gadgets, home examinations, and cutting-edge treatments for sleep apnea.


Wearable Sleep Trackers


Wearable sleep trackers have gotten appeal as a result of their convenience and availability. Instruments such as smartwatches and fitness bands monitor sleep period, quality, and patterns. They generally utilize sensors to measure heart price, body language, and occasionally body temperature level.


Customers can obtain detailed analyses of their rest phases, such as rapid eye movement and deep rest. Lots of trackers likewise use individualized understandings to enhance sleep hygiene. These understandings often include referrals for adjustments in going to bed routines or environmental changes.


The information gathered can be synced with mobile applications, allowing users to monitor rest patterns in time. This makes wearables a valuable tool for both people and doctor wanting to enhance rest health and wellness.


Home Sleep Examinations


Home sleep examinations (HSTs) supply an option to traditional lab-based rest studies. These examinations are developed to detect sleep disorders, generally sleep apnea, in the convenience of one's home. People can utilize mobile surveillance gadgets that capture crucial sleep metrics, such as air movement, oxygen levels, and heart price.


HSTs are much less invasive and extra cost-efficient than over night stays in a rest center. The data from these tests is typically evaluated by rest specialists, who can then advise ideal therapy. Consequently, home rest tests are becoming an indispensable part of contemporary sleep medicine.


Raised availability to these tests enables even more individuals to look for aid for rest issues than ever before. It is vital, nonetheless, that they enhance clinical consultations for accurate medical diagnoses.


Breakthroughs in Rest Apnea Therapy


Current advancements in the treatment of sleep apnea consist of continual favorable airway stress (CPAP) therapy developments and the advancement of alternative devices. Traditional CPAP machines can be cumbersome, resulting in conformity problems; nevertheless, newer models are a lot more small and quieter.


Furthermore, oral devices made to reposition the jaw during rest have actually become much more effective. These devices are personalized to every patient's demands, making them a positive choice for many.


Minimally intrusive surgical options are likewise readily available for details situations of sleep apnea. These treatments aim to attend to anatomical concerns that add to airway obstruction. With these advancements, people have a bigger variety of treatment options to handle their sleep apnea effectively.



Producing a Sleep-Conducive Setting


A well-structured sleep atmosphere is vital for cultivating high quality remainder. Key elements include maximizing the bedroom design, taking care of light and noise, and picking the best bed linen. Each variable adds considerably to total rest health.


Enhancing Your Room for Rest


Developing a devoted sleep area includes mindful consideration of the space's layout. The bed room needs to be free from interruptions and mess, advertising leisure. Placing the bed far from the door and making sure comfy temperature levels can improve convenience.


Picking relaxing colors for walls and design can produce a relaxing environment. Soft, muted tones like pale blues or greens are frequently recommended. Additionally, maintaining a spick-and-span setting helps in reducing anxiousness, making sleep extra accessible.


The Duty of Light and Sound Control


Controlling light levels is essential for signaling the body when it is time to rest. Blackout drapes or tones can block outdoors lights effectively. Dimming lights an hour prior to going to bed prepares the body for remainder.


Sound control is just as crucial. Utilizing white noise devices can mask turbulent noises. Earplugs or soundproofing steps can further enhance the bedroom's acoustic setting, promoting nonstop sleep cycles.


Bed Linens and Sleep Convenience


Selecting the appropriate bed linen is important for boosting sleep convenience. A mattress that fits specific preferences-- whether company or soft-- plays a significant function. Cushions must sustain the head and neck appropriately, customized to resting positions.


Selecting breathable textiles for sheets can help control temperature level. Natural materials like cotton or bamboo are usually recommended for their comfort and moisture-wicking homes. Layering coverings permits adaptability to altering temperature levels throughout the evening.



Society and Sleep


Different societal aspects significantly influence sleep patterns and health and wellness. These variables consist of social practices, the demands of shift work, and the economic implications of sleep conditions. Each element plays an essential function in shaping how individuals experience and prioritize rest.


Society and Rest Practices


Social perspectives in the direction of rest vary commonly across societies. In some cultures, napping is encouraged, while in others, it is considered as an indicator of idleness. As an example, siestas in Spanish-speaking nations promote rest throughout the day, whereas in several Western nations, a full evening's rest is prioritized.


Cultural routines bordering sleep, such as going to bed stories or relaxation strategies, can boost rest find more quality. Rest health methods vary, consisting of using displays prior to bed, which is typically dissuaded in cultures that stress early rest.


Shift Job and Its Difficulties


Change work poses details obstacles to rest health. People working non-traditional hours often experience an interfered with circadian rhythm, bring about problem falling asleep or staying asleep. This can cause too much exhaustion and lowered performance.


Lots of change employees report problems such as insomnia and decreased rest period. Incorporating calculated snoozes during breaks and adhering to a consistent sleep timetable can aid reduce a few of these difficulties.


The Economic Effect of Rest Disorders


Rest conditions bring substantial financial effects for society. Price quotes recommend that sleep-related issues cost organizations billions every year in shed performance and raised health care expenses. Problems like sleep problems or obstructive rest apnea typically lead to greater absenteeism prices.


Purchasing office rest programs can reduce these costs. Companies that promote rest health through education and learning and resources might see improved employee performance and lower turn over rates. As recognition of sleep health and wellness grows, resolving these problems ends up being increasingly important for both people and organizations.
